Got out to the center of town for a couple of hours where i have been hunting here in Avon Park, Fl. Ive tried a lot of different ways to hunt it just because it has years of trash, metal lines and electrical line, EMI and who knows what elce. Its a tuff hunt so i went back to basics... i mean restarted in factory opened up the IM, left fast and deep off per Bryce's recommendation... which did make the tones longer. I did manage to get a few deeper coins to include to silver merc's the oldest 1917 and one 1898 IH. That not bad since there has been at least 5 hunters going thru the area every sunday for the past 4 weeks or so. There were two there when i started swinging. Its always nice to pull good coins out that others have missed... to include me. 3" is still about as deep as i seem to be able to get. Anyone have any ideas for more depth let me know. Dont say small coil... lol, i dont have one here. Im useing the SEF and its does seem to really seperate very well.

Congrats on the finds Dew..nothing like finding coins over the same ground others have treked over!!..As far as getting deeper, with that SEF, I dont think it matters how you set up deep on or off..you will get DEEP!!..Maybe all the surface trash is keeping you from hearing the deep stuff? I think Bryce likes his gain high, so I think that makes everything kind of sound at the same depth. So using that setting , u probably have to keep checking visually as far as how deep u are , and that surface trash may get a little tough too. I never tried his settings yet so I dont know for sure. Again he has been using those settings for a while, so experience counts for alot! Now if you didnt change the gain to max( I like 5, easy for me to hear deep from shallow) and you still switched off fast and deep, I guess you may miss hearing some deep stuff..But with that SEF, I would think u still would get down pretty deep. Remember, fast and deep are off, but he increases his gain and that makes up for it as far as hearing the deeps. Pick his brain, hes more than helpful in answering questions. For me right now, I like ferrous, deep on, gain 5. there is alot of iron in the parks I hunt, and trash. gets me down nice and deep too. and there are so many targets, it would take me all day of looking back and forth to get 50 feet!! I actually tried upping my gain to 6 the other day, and it screwed me up!!..lol..my wife says Im too thick headed and that proves it. Hope my reply has been helpful.Good luck:usaflag:
 
The best way to find out what will work is find a target, you think is a coin that sounds iffy deep, and then go thru your settings and see what makes it sound better.....Deep off, lower sens, lower gain, or a combo, lower sens but keep gain higher, or the opposite, find a good target and figure it out...it works for me....you can go into menu and change anything and reswing as you go....
